Offering a deep dive into biblical texts, this series shifts away from conventional sermon formats to provide an extended exploration of scripture. Each episode is anchored in contemporary scholarship, aiming to enrich listeners' understanding of the historical and theological contexts of the Bible. Key discussions frequently focus on significant historical events, such as the Babylonian exile, the significance of pivotal characters, and the evolution of religious beliefs through time. This approach not only engages listeners with the depth of scripture but also invites them to connect these ancient narratives with contemporary faith practices and challenges.
